Maps from open sources have shown that Ukraine’s positions in the Kursk oblast have sharply deteriorated, and the day before yesterday reports emerged that Ukrainian forces are nearly encircled by the russians. Sky News writes about this.
The publication refers to pro-russian military bloggers who claimed yesterday that russian forces have begun an assault on Sudzha, the main city of the Kursk oblast, which Ukraine has held since the start of its surprise offensive in August last year.
Security and defense analyst Michael Clarke says that holding Sudzha is crucial for Ukraine to maintain a foothold in the region, which in turn would give it a stronger position in potential peace negotiations with moscow.
"Undoubtedly, the russians want to close this pocket before they are involved in any peace negotiations over territory because if the pocket is still there, they will have to trade it for something", - he said.
It was previously reported that the General Staff of the Armed Forces of Ukraine stated that the situation in the Kursk oblast remains under the control of command.
